Google Knowledge panels are information boxes that appear on Google when you search for entities (people, places, organizations, things) that are in the Knowledge Graph. They are meant to help you get a quick snapshot of information on a topic based on Google's understanding of available content on the web.

Sometimes Google Search will show special boxes with information about people, places and things. We call these knowledge panels. ... Information within knowledge panels comes from Knowledge Graph, which is like a giant virtual encyclopedia of facts.
